I feel that there should be a generalized interface for disabling of bundles of mime types. There is a menu selection called "block images from this site" which presumably blocks jpeg, gif, png and a host of other stuff. If this was generalized, it would be possible to escape the butt-ugly flashing flash ads several sites seem to find so necessary. So: I would like a generalized menu choice to block some predefined form of content, and I would also like to be able to disable certain mime types alltogether in the mime/helper applications box. It already has a "save to file", I would like a "save to /dev/null" as well. If the menu selection were used to try to block content for a /dev/nulled mimetype, the user should be told. If it is not blocked, a hyperlink to the mime/helper applications with the legend "global blocking functionality" should be shown. It would also be nice if this was taken even one step further, to javascripts and java applets within pages. Not a mime type or separate files that are downloaded, but bothersome in some sites nonetheless. Please feel free to contact me if anything is unclear.
